Co to jest kopanie kryptowalut? Mining w blockchain?

in #polish6 years ago

jonny-caspari-383401-unsplash.jpg

Kopanie, czyli wydobywamy kryptowalutę


Omówmy najpopularniejszą formę


To trochę śmieszna nazwa. Nie odnosi się do tego co robią komputery. Bardziej pasowałoby liczenie. Liczenie kryptowalut.

Kopanie występuje w różnych formach. Najczęściej odnosi się do najbardziej znanej formy “dowodu pracy”, czyli Proof of Work. Żeby kryptowaluta została wykopana trzeba wykonać pracę, najczęściej względnie ciężką i pokazać wszystkim dowód, że się wykonało to. Zapisuje się ten dowód i transakcje w blockchain i tyle.

Co stoi za kopaniem?


Kopanie to inaczej liczenie. Dokładniej specjalnej, ciężkiej formuły matematycznej. Wymaga to dużo mocy obliczeniowej komputera i czasu. Przyzwyczailiśmy się do komputerów natychmiast zwracających wynik w kalkulatorze. Wyobraźcie sobie teraz obliczenia, które wymagają kilku minut “myślenia” dla maszyny. Właśnie takie zadanie otrzymuje komputer.

Próbuje rozwiązać matematyczne zadanie i wrzuca jej rozwiązanie do blockchain. W zamian otrzymuje trochę kryptowaluty, a nasza transakcja zostaje potwierdzona. Wszyscy na tym korzystają.

Zrobimy to razem?


Istnieje jeszcze inna forma - Proof of Stake. Działa na trochę innej zasadzie. Tutaj komputer dostaje prostsze zadanie matematyczne, które nie pochłania dużo czasu. To troche niebezpieczne, bo proste zadanie łatwo zmienić jak się da inne dane a wynik utrzymać ten sam. Dlatego w tym przypadku dajesz swoją kryptowalutę w zastaw, na przykład 1000 zł i mówisz moje zadanie jest poprawne. Robią to także inni a potem porównują swoje wyniki. Jeśli źle rozwiązałeś tracisz. Jeśli dobrze dostajesz nagrodę.

Pod względem ekonomicznym ten system jest o wiele bardziej oszczędny. Komputer nie musi tyle liczyć co oszczędza prąd i nasze pieniądze. Problemem staje się ilość osób używających takiego kopania. Musi być ich sporo, żeby pokazać że się nie umawiają i oszukują. Najczęściej jednak chęć zysku na graniu według zasad jest bardziej opłacalna niż próba podrobienia transakcji.

Te dwie formy kopania są obecnie najważniejsze i stanowią podstawę. Powstają ciągle wariacje i modyfikacja pozwalające na szybsze potwierdzanie, kopanie, większą oszczędność czy bezpieczeństwo.

Warto się też zapoznać z wpisem: https://blog.patys.pl/2017/10/27/kryptografia-blockchain-czyli-dlaczego-nikt-nie-moze-ukrasc-moich-pieniedzy-poradnik/ który dokładniej omawia zagadnienia związane z kopaniem i bezpieczeństwem blockchain.